plight
(pl/aI/t )
noun
(n)
a situation from which extrication is difficult especially an unpleasant or trying one
(noun.state)
Example:
The woeful plight of homeless people.
Synonym:
predicament
,
quandary
source: wordnet30
a solemn pledge of fidelity
(noun.communication)
Synonym:
troth
source: wordnet30
A network; a plait; a fold; rarely a garment.
(noun)
source: webster1913
That which is exposed to risk; that which is plighted or pledged; security; a gage; a pledge.
(noun)
source: webster1913
verb
(v)
give to in marriage
(verb.communication)
Synonym:
affiance
,
betroth
,
engage
source: wordnet30
promise solemnly and formally
(verb.communication)
Synonym:
pledge
source: wordnet30
To weave; to braid; to fold; to plait.
(verb)
source: webster1913
To pledge; to give as a pledge for the performance of some act; as, to
plight
faith, honor, word; -- never applied to property or goods.
(verb)
source: webster1913
